1. They Keep Your Pool Cleaner Year Round
Pool cages block debris that falls or blows into the water. Leaves, pollen, insects, and small branches are common issues in outdoor pools. When this debris enters the water, the pool needs more cleaning, brushing, and chemical adjustment. A screened enclosure reduces the amount of debris that reaches the surface. This makes the water easier to maintain.
Cleaner pools require fewer chemical changes. Homeowners spend less time vacuuming and skimming. Pumps and filters also work under lighter strain. This can lower maintenance costs over time. A pool cage supports a more stable water environment throughout the year. For many homeowners this is one of the first advantages they notice after installation.
2. They Add Shade and Comfort in Florida’s Heat
Florida summers bring strong sunlight and high temperatures. Pool cages help reduce direct sun exposure while still allowing open airflow. The screen material filters some of the heat and brightness coming into the pool area. This makes the space feel more comfortable during hot afternoons.
Shade also protects outdoor furniture and surfaces. Many outdoor materials fade when exposed to strong sun for long periods. A screened enclosure reduces this wear. It also helps keep decks and seating areas cooler. The result is a space that can be used for more hours each day with less discomfort.
People often prefer swimming when temperatures are balanced. When sunlight is softened, pool water can stay at a more manageable temperature. This supports regular use throughout the year without extreme heat conditions.

5. They Offer Safety and Peace of Mind
Pool cages act as a barrier around the pool area. This helps families feel safer when children are playing outside. Pets also benefit from the enclosure, because it reduces the chance of entering the pool without supervision. Homeowners can enjoy the outdoor space with more confidence knowing that the area is enclosed on all sides.
The enclosure also helps limit wildlife. Florida properties often see birds, lizards, snakes, and other small animals. A screened enclosure reduces the chance of these animals entering the pool area. This makes the space cleaner and easier to use throughout the day.
Many residents prefer using the pool area at night. Lighting inside the enclosure creates a safe and calm environment. With the added barrier, homeowners feel more secure when walking or swimming after sunset.
6. They Protect Against Bugs and Pests
Mosquitoes, flies, and other pests can make outdoor activities difficult. Screened enclosures help prevent these insects from entering the pool area. This allows residents to dine, read, or relax without constant interruption. Florida has long periods of warm and humid weather that allow insects to thrive. A pool cage offers consistent protection during these seasons.
A bug free environment also supports outdoor meals and gatherings. Families can use the enclosed area as an outdoor dining room. Many homeowners also find that their children spend more time outside when bites and insects are not a concern.
Better pest control increases the number of hours the pool area can be used. Even during humid months, an enclosed and screened space remains comfortable and practical.
